Tender description

Support and maintenance for 12 months to the current case management system used by Children's Social Care at Bracknell Forest Council, Mosaic. The software is hosted in our BFC Azure environment, and the Council controls the core licences. The support and maintenance agreement means support is available if there is a fundamental issue with the product's core configuration and allows the Council to access upgrades. This case management system is critical to the operation of a core Council service and our ability to support the needs of children and young people, and ongoing support and maintenance is necessary for the continued operation of the system. ## Contract award Title: Mosaic Support & Maintenance Agreement
